During the 1930s to the 1970s, a large number of American workers breathed and handled asbestos fibers that were hazardous in their workplace. The carcinogen was present in numerous products, asbestos such as insulation for pipes, fireproofing, cements and plasters asbestos ceiling tiles, auto brakes, and many more. Many of these companies were aware about the connection between mesothelioma as well as asbestos, but kept the information from their employees as well as the public to maximize profit.

As asbestos-related diseases became more common, manufacturers that went bankrupt established trust funds to cover victims' medical expenses and other losses. These trusts hold more than $30 billion. Many workers were exposed asbestos in industrial settings, including shipyards, steel mills, and construction sites. Asbestos was also utilized in a variety of commercial and household products such as insulations, fireproofings, cements, plasters and car brakes, among others. Asbestos is a cause of a range of medical conditions, such as mesothelioma, lung cancer, and asbestosis.

In the majority of cases, exposure to asbestos does not cause immediate symptoms. Asbestos-related ailments, such as mesothelioma, are not recognized until later stages of the disease. Asbestos symptoms usually do not manifest until between 25 and 50 years after exposure. A majority of victims have only just a few months left to live.

Mesothelioma victims and their families are able to seek compensation for past, present and future damages from people who caused asbestos exposure. A successful settlement or verdict may cover medical bills, lost wages and a reduced quality of life. It can also cover funeral and burial costs along with pain and suffering, loss of consortium as well as other losses as a result of your illness.

Many victims are exposed to asbestos at work. Before the mid-1970s asbestos was employed in many industries, including shipyard repairs, heating systems construction, and automobile manufacturing. Inhaling asbestos fibers cause a variety of ailments, including mesothelioma (lung cancer) as well as pleural effusions and asbestosis.
